General Mechanical Engineering is the 14th most popular major in the country with 46,178 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.

Across New York, there were 2,839 general mechanical engineering gra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

This year’s “Best Value General Mechanical Engineering Schools in New York For Those Getting Aid” ranking analyzed 21 colleges that offered a degree in general mechanical engineering. The schools that top this list are recognized because they have great general mechanical engineering programs and cost less that schools of similar quality.

When determining these rankings, we looked at things such as overall quality of the general mechanical engineering program at the school and the cost to attend the school once aid has been awarded. Check out our ranking methodology for more information.
